			<description><![CDATA[<p>I examined your GIFs and found an additional issue: their color mode is RGB. GIFs need to be <em>Indexed</em> color, not RGB.

			<description><![CDATA[<p>I guess the problem is the extreme size of the files. The last gif in the post you linked to is 5.4MB, 283 frames, and the previous one is an impossible 15.2MB, 428 frames. You need to create/insert videos instead of gifs.

			<description><![CDATA[<p>I've just started using WordPress, and cannot get animated gifs to correctly display on my blog. Here is a post with several, and an <a href="http://tdauntless.wordpress.com/2012/11/13/rupauls-drag-race-all-starts-episode-4-all-star-girl-groups-recap/#gifs">anchor</a> to where two should show:</p>
<p>I can see them in my editing preview, and the public page shows links to them, but the images themselves don't show.</p>
<p>I've checked and double-checked that they've been uploaded and added at full, original size. I created them in a video-editing program, and they're 320x240, 20 FPS, and uncompressed, according to those settings. I'm using Splendio, which says their width <a href="http://wpbtips.wordpress.com/2009/07/23/maximum-image-width/">shouldn't be a problem</a>. </p>
<p>Could anybody help? Thanks so much for taking a look!
